We had such a relaxing holiday weekend. Laquita greeted us upon arrival and made sure we had everything that we needed. The property is beautiful and well kept. We enjoyed multiple daily walks around the property and through the creek with our dog.
Each RV site had electric and water hookups. We were in site 2, which was spacious and well shaded most of the day.
All 8 RV sites were occupied through the weekend. Everyone was very friendly and respectful. I thought it might seem crowded, but that was not the case at all! Everyone had plenty of space to spend with their families and there was plenty of room for multiple parties to hang out by the creek, as well.
We will be back, I'm sure.

We picked the perfect time to stay at Heavener Runestone. The weather was beautiful, the trees were beautiful, and the park was very peaceful. There was a lot of activity during the day with hikers, but few overnight campers this time of year.
The site is very hilly and includes a pavilion with tables, which was great for our group. We had one tent with us and, while there was not a designated tent pad at this site like there are at others, we were able to find a relatively flat area to set the tent up.
The host was very helpful and responded to any questions within minutes. The listing stated that there was water available at this site, but the water was not working. The host offered solutions, including offering water hoses to assist us in tapping into the water at another campsite. Our camper was small with a small fresh water tank, so we were able to quickly fill our tank without the use of extra water hose, but I appreciated the effort to help resolve the issue. I believe they are in the process of fixing the water at this site.
We enjoyed our stay very much and it was a great ending to our camping adventures for the year.
